The goal of this clinical trial is to determine whether boxing training reduces cardiovascular risk in elevated blood pressure or hypertension stage 1 individuals.

The main questions it aims to answer are (1) if boxing training reduces peripheral and central blood pressure and (2) if boxing training improves cardiovascular function in elevated blood pressure or hypertension stage 1 individuals.

Participants with elevated blood pressure or hypertension stage 1 will be randomly divided into a control group or an intervention group. The latter group will be involved in boxing training, 3 days per week for 6 weeks.

Researchers will compare clinical and cardiovascular outcomes between the control and the intervention group.

Inclusion criteria

  • ≥18 years old.
  • Systolic blood pressure between 120-139 mmHg and/or diastolic blood pressure between 80-89 mmHg obtained from 2 different days.
  • an estimated 10-year risk of CVD ≤10%, calculated by the ACC/AHA Pooled Cohort Equations.
  • no current participation in 3 or more days per week of endurance or resistance exercise training.

Exclusion criteria

  • non-controlled cardiac, pulmonary, or metabolic diseases.
  • smoking, consumption of nutritional supplements containing antioxidants.
  • any physical impairment to exercise.
